Output e8ecbbeab9de5734565647bb82947ccfd1733a1c40003dd448e38feb8b42c4b9:0

value
8515805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2346b2e388497500054fbfbc1685ca6743c181f5 OP_EQUAL
address
34uYGVh2XYszKsR7d1Ro3PD39gYExVCCuC
transaction
e8ecbbeab9de5734565647bb82947ccfd1733a1c40003dd448e38feb8b42c4b9
spent
true